I just made these and made it up as i went along, but it seemed to work and they're very tasty!

ok, you will need:

1 bag of chocolate toffee eclaires
butter
rice crispies/cornflakes

what you do:

1. fill a small saucepan with water and place a glass bowl over the top.
2. Bring the water to the boil and add a small knob of butter to the bowl and allow it to melt.
3. Add the eclaires a few at a time to the bowl and stir often to stop them sticking to the bowl till they melt (this may take quite a while, but think of the final product... mmm)
4. Once you've melted all the eclaires (they need to be quite runny), add in a handful of rice crispies/cornflakes at a time stirring to cover them in the toffee mixture, until you cant add anymore.
5. plop out onto a baking tray and spread out thickly
6. pop into the fridge to cool and set
7. once cooled and set, there is the option of melting and pouring a layer of chocolate over the top, but it's up to you, i prefer not to.

and thats it.
